简介:本文详细探讨了Linux NFS服务客户端的配置步骤、常见问题及解决方法,并介绍了NFS服务的优势与应用场景,以及如何通过千帆大模型开发与服务平台优化NFS服务。
在Linux系统中,NFS(Network File System)服务允许不同主机之间通过网络共享文件和目录,这一功能极大地促进了数据的高效管理和访问。本文将深入探讨Linux NFS服务客户端的配置过程、常见问题排查,并介绍如何通过千帆大模型开发与服务平台来优化NFS服务。
NFS,即网络文件系统,由Sun公司开发,基于RPC(Remote Procedure Call Protocol,远程过程调用协议)实现。它允许用户和程序像访问本地文件一样访问远端系统上的文件,极大地简化了文件共享和访问的过程。NFS服务主要依赖于rpcbind(或portmap)和nfs-utils两个软件包,分别负责RPC端口映射和NFS服务的具体实现。
在配置NFS服务客户端之前,需要确保NFS服务端已经正确配置并正在运行。同时,客户端和服务器之间的网络连接也需要正常。
在Linux客户端上,首先需要安装NFS客户端软件。这通常可以通过包管理器来完成,例如在CentOS或RHEL上,可以使用以下命令:
yum install nfs-utils -y
使用showmount -e <NFS服务器IP>命令可以查看NFS服务器共享的目录资源。
在客户端上,可以使用mount命令手动挂载NFS共享目录。例如:
mount -t nfs <NFS服务器IP>:<共享目录路径> <本地挂载目录>
为了在系统启动时自动挂载NFS共享目录,可以将挂载信息添加到/etc/fstab文件中。例如:
<NFS服务器IP>:<共享目录路径> <本地挂载目录> nfs defaults 0 0
如果客户端无法连接到NFS服务器,首先需要检查网络连接是否正常,以及NFS服务器是否正在运行并共享了相应的目录。可以使用ping命令测试网络连接,使用showmount -e命令检查共享情况。
如果挂载失败,可能是由于NFS版本不一致、权限设置不正确或配置文件错误等原因造成的。可以检查NFS客户端和服务器的版本是否一致,确保客户端机器上的用户有权限访问NFS共享目录,并检查/etc/fstab文件中的挂载信息是否正确。
在高并发情况下,NFS服务器可能会出现性能瓶颈。这可以通过优化服务器配置、增加内存和CPU资源或使用更高效的分布式文件系统来解决。
NFS服务具有部署简单快捷、维护简单以及节省客户端本地存储空间等优势。它广泛应用于家庭网络存储、云存储服务、远程办公以及大型零售商等领域。
千帆大模型开发与服务平台提供了丰富的工具和资源,可以帮助用户更好地配置和优化NFS服务。例如,用户可以利用平台上的监控工具实时监控NFS服务的性能和状态,及时发现并解决问题。同时,平台还提供了丰富的文档和社区支持,用户可以轻松获取NFS服务的配置和优化建议。
假设用户在使用NFS服务时遇到了性能瓶颈问题。此时,用户可以利用千帆大模型开发与服务平台上的监控工具对NFS服务的性能进行实时监控和分析。通过分析监控数据,用户可以确定性能瓶颈的具体位置(如网络延迟、服务器负载过高等)。然后,用户可以根据分析结果采取相应的优化措施(如增加网络带宽、升级服务器硬件等),从而提高NFS服务的性能和稳定性。
综上所述,Linux NFS服务客户端的配置与故障排查是一个复杂而重要的过程。通过深入了解NFS服务的原理和工作机制,以及掌握常见的配置和排查技巧,用户可以更好地利用NFS服务实现文件共享和访问的高效管理。同时,借助千帆大模型开发与服务平台等工具和资源,用户可以进一步优化NFS服务的性能和稳定性,满足不断增长的数据管理和访问需求。